This isnโt a typical personal website.
As a Frontend Engineer with a focus on OTT, Streaming, and SmartTV applications, I wanted to do something different.
๐ Live demo: https://braggio.dev/
Itโs a TV-first streaming app pretending your browser is a Smart TV ๐บ
(yes, you can navigate it with โ โ โ โ + Enter).
Whatโs inside? ๐
Remote-first navigation (actual TV-style focus, not โtab until it worksโ)
Real-time QoS dashboard (bitrate, buffer health, dropped frames)
Multiple video players under one abstraction (Shaka, HLS.js, Dash.js, Video.js, RX Player)
React 18 + TypeScript + Vite
@noriginmedia/norigin-spatial-navigation doing the heavy lifting
Tailwind CSS + shadcn/ui (glassmorphic dark vibes)
Three.js via @react-three/fiber becauseโฆ why not โจ
๐ก The idea was simple:
My portfolio shouldnโt talk about OTT apps I develop. It should be one.
If youโre into frontend, OTT, Smart TV apps (or just curious), Iโd love to hear what you think ๐ ๐ฟ
Top comments (2)
Amazing portfolio, the user experience really stands out, and the attention to detail is impressive. Great work
Appreciate it, and thanks for the feedback @s3lv3r :)